How to do the Dumbbell Chest Fly

Chest · also works front delts

Step by step

  1. Lie on a bench holding a dumbbell in each hand pressed above your chest.
  2. Keep a slight, fixed bend in your elbows like you are hugging a barrel.
  3. Open your arms out to the sides in a wide arc, lowering until you feel a chest stretch.
  4. Squeeze your chest to bring the dumbbells back together over your chest.
The thing people get wrong

Keep that soft elbow bend locked the whole time and stop where the stretch is comfortable - going too deep strains the shoulder joint.

Coaching cue

Use much lighter weights than you press; the long arm position multiplies the load.

Stay safe

Keep the dumbbells over your chest, not over your face, so a slip cannot land on your head.
